Transaction e88d413f5cd2873e4fcf304a7691127b5040acda79bad98a85f4a2778da16e84
1 Input
1 Output
-
e88d413f5cd2873e4fcf304a7691127b5040acda79bad98a85f4a2778da16e84:0
- value
- 134270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fabee03e84af81c348196e0a0ac0a56f9df84806 OP_EQUAL
- address
- 3QYqWo57c9tupvSRrcta1rKphLoVDfn6vu